Death ‘Vivus!’ Live Double Disc Collection Due in Winter

by | Nov 30, 2011

Relapse will issue a 2-CD live Death collection, Vivus!, on February 28th in North America, March 2nd in the Benelux/Germany, and March 5th in the UK and rest of Europe.

The outing will sport two discs of recordings from 1998: a performance at the Whisky A Go-Go in Los Angeles and a recording from Dynamo Open Air festival.
